Material Fact

 

In compliance with Paragraph 4 of Article 157 of Law No. 6,404/76 and CVM Instruction No. 358/2002, Banco Bradesco S.A. (Bradesco) hereby informs the market that it is adjusting its guidance for 2016 (New Guidance), as a result of the conclusion of the operation to acquire HSBC Bank Brasil S.A. – Banco Múltiplo (HSBC Brasil), on July 1, 2016.

 

The New Guidance does not impact the annual result expected based on previous projection.

 

Additionally, the “Pro Forma” column on the table below informs the joint projection of Bradesco and HSBC Brasil, based on the sum of the banks’ historic data. Data on the “Pro Forma” column is merely illustrative and should not be considered as effective.

 

 

         
    New Guidance    "Pro Forma" 
Indicator  Previous Projection  Considering HSBC Brasil as of    Considering HSBC Brasil as of 
    the third quarter of 2016    January 2015 
Loan Portfolio(1)  -4% to 0%  8% to 12%    -7% to -3% 
Individuals  1% to 5%  13% to 17%    0% to 4% 
Companies  -7% to -3%  5% to 9%    -9% to -5% 
Interest Earning Portion  7% to 11%  13% to 17%    3% to 7% 
Fee and Commission Income  7% to 11%  12% to 16%    3% to 7% 
Operating Expenses(2)  4% to 8%  12% to 16%    -2% to 2% 
Insurance Premiums  8% to 12%  8% to 12%    8% to 12% 
ALL Expenses (-) Credits Recovered(3)  (18,000) to (20,000)  (20,000) to (22,500)    (22,500) to (25,000) 

(1) Expanded Loan Portfolio 

     
(2) Administrative and Personnel Expenses     
(3) R$ Million
